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o Controlled Trial Assessing The Effects Of An Oral Dietary Supplement Containing Marine And Plant Extracts On Overall Facial Skin Appearance Among Healthy Adult Women With Photo-aged Skin

简要总结
The study hypothesis is that Imedeen will show effects on skin health, when compared to placebo over a 6 month intervention period with respect to changes in skin appearance, skin density, moisture, and in fine lines and wrinkles.

入选标准
- •In general good health and have no contraindications to the study product; Have Fitzpatrick Skin Type I-IV as determined by a trained evaluator. Have Glogau Classification of Photoaging of II or III as determined by the investigator.
排除标准
- •Use of any dietary supplement, over-the-counter or prescription product with the indication of improving the appearance or condition of the skin within one month of baseline.
- •History of or current disease or condition of the skin that the investigator deems inappropriate for participation (eg, atopic skin, facial scars, psoriasis, eczema, other scaly inflammatory diseases).
- •Subjects who have had a facial cosmetic procedures (eg, fillers, toxins, facial peel) or invasive surgical procedures (eg, laser treatment or face lift) or other facial treatments by a physician or skin care professional within the last 6 to 9 months from baseline (pending procedure type) or plan to have a treatment during the study.

主要结局
Change From Baseline in Investigator Global Assessment (IGA) of Participant's Overall Facial Appearance at Week 24
时间窗: Baseline, Week 24
IGA of overall facial appearance was measured using a numerical severity rating scale of 0 to 9 using 1/2 points, where 0 to less than or equal to (\<=) 3 signifies Mild; greater than (\>) 3 to \<=6 signifies Moderate and \>6 to \<=9 signifies Severe.
